BrainGate2 speech study for people with tetraplegia
Part of Bones, joints & muscles, Brain & nervous system, Genetic & congenital, Heart & circulation, Hormones & metabolism, Injuries & trauma clinical trials.
This study tests a brain-computer interface to help people with severe paralysis communicate by decoding attempted speech or movements. It may offer a new way to interact with devices using only brain signals.
Summary written for real people, not researchers, by Clin2.
Who can take part
- You must be between 18 and 80 years old.
- You have a diagnosis of spinal cord injury, brainstem stroke, muscular dystrophy, ALS, or similar motor neuron condition.
- You have complete or partial paralysis of all four limbs (tetraplegia).
- You live within a 3-hour drive of the study site and can stay nearby for at least 15 months.
- You are not currently taking steroids or medications that suppress your immune system.
